Abstract:

Transportation connection has always been one of the important perspectives of studying spatial cascading systems and urban systems. Based on the timetable data in 2018 of inter-city coach, high-speed train and aviation, this paper builds networks of the three modes of transportation in China. Through the methods of the city-pair connectivity and community detection, this paper compares the spatial structure and linkage systems of multi-traffic flow network and reveals the geospatial constraints. The research results show that: (1) Different modes of transportation are suitable for portraying urban systems on different spatial and administrative scales. Inter-city coaches are constrained by the provincial administrative boundaries. High-speed train network shows the effect of corridors especially along the main trunks. The aviation network reflects the spatial relationship at the national scale. (2) From the perspective of the direct accessibility, there is a large spatial overlap between inter-city coaches and high-speed trains, and the market of inter-city coaches is obviously squeezed in recent years. For air transport, its frequency advantage mainly concentrates on the city-pairs with a long distance. The competition and complementarity of the three modes of transportation have a great impact on the urban system and are useful for the understanding of the spatial cascading system. (3) Geographical space, infrastructure space and administrative space constraint and management system are important factors affecting the transportation networks. Inter-city coach network and high-speed train network are obviously affected by distance attenuation effects, and they present significant community structures in the two networks, but their communities have different spatial characteristics. However, air transport does not follow the constraint of distance attenuation, and there is not an obvious community structure in the network. Factors related to the passenger transport market, such as social and economic links and tourism resources, play the important roles in the aviation network structure.
